Precious gemstone and mineral mining firm Tsar Emerald Corporation is planning to join AIM later this month.

Vancouver-based Tsar Emerald is focused on mining, processing and selling emeralds, alexandrites and other precious gemstones and minerals sourced from the Malyshev mine in Western Siberia in Russia.

The company began production at the mine in October 2006 and aims to bring it back to its former capacity of about three million carats of emeralds a year.

Tsar Emerald will not be raising any capital as part of its admission and has not announced what its expected share price or market capitalisation will be. The company is scheduled to join AIM on June 19.

Nabarro Wells & Co is Tsar Emerald’s nominated adviser, while ODL Securities is the broker.
